‘A movie for everyone, not just Drag Race fans’: stars of drag comedy Stop! That! Train! on making the summer’s funniest film

Drag queens Jujubee and Ginger Minj, stars of the new disaster-comedy "Stop! That! Train!", described their press tour as mirroring the movie's production, a whirlwind that has them scheduling sleep but remaining high on life. The film, directed by Adam Shankman, is described as a "brilliantly madcap twist on Airplane! style parody" and aims to appeal to a broad audience, not just fans of "RuPaul's Drag Race". Jujubee and Minj, both former contestants on "RuPaul's Drag Race", appeared in coordinated cheetah print outfits during their interview, maintaining a high level of energy and engagement. They noted the taxing nature of constant press events but emphasized their ability to stay in the moment and enjoy the experience. The film's promotional activities included a stop at NBC's "Today with Jenna & Sheinelle". The actors highlighted the collaborative and energetic atmosphere on set, which has translated into their current promotional efforts. They expressed excitement about the film's potential to entertain a wide range of viewers, positioning it as a summer comedy.
